Background technique:
Tapping machine is exactly a kind of lathe with screw tap machining internal thread, it is a kind of most widely used internal thread machining machine Bed.By national machinery industry standard, tapping machine series composition is divided into: bench tapping machine -- semi-automatic bench tapping machine vertical is attacked Silk machine, Horizontal tap.Because a kind of important classification being most widely used of certain reason is not included in wherein, i.e. folding arm tapping machine (hydraulic pressure threading machine, electric threading machine, pneumatic tapper).
Tapping machine when carrying out tapping to strainer cover needs that strainer cover is manually placed on to tapping fixing card one by one On seat, when placement, need through manual control, by two symmetrical fixation holes and tapping fixing card on strainer cover Seat aligns, and just strainer cover can be made to be fixed on tapping Fixing clamp-seat, then just can be carried out the operation of tapping.
However when being fed using automatic feeder, being easy to appear adjustment disk cannot effectively drive strainer cover to turn It is dynamic, so that the first adjusting rod can not be made to fix strainer cover, realize the automatic positioning of strainer cover, or even by strainer cover into Row damage.

The present invention for strainer cover tapping charging with automatic positioning equipment when in use:
(1) strainer cover 10 is uniformly placed on conveyer belt 8, when strainer cover 10 moves between feedboard 14, By controller 86, stop conveyer belt 8, start the first electro-hydraulic device 11, make push plate 13, by strainer cover 10 into The push of 5 one end of hopper;
(2) when strainer cover 10 is pushed to 5 upper end of feed well, since deflector 39 enters positioning by feed well 5 In slot 38, in feedboard 14 while promoting, feedboard 14 pushes forward driver plate 18, drives adjustable plate by driver plate 18 3 rotation rotates down adjustable plate 3 counterclockwise, and the second adjusting rod 44 is contacted with 10 upper surface of strainer cover;
(3) motor 43 is then adjusted by the starting of controller 86 first, drives adjustment disk 40 to turn right to the left identical Angle, to make 10 left-right rotation of strainer cover in locating slot 38 by the frictional force of rubber, enable the second adjusting rod 44 The preferably fixation hole 66 on alignment strainer cover 10, when the second adjusting rod 44 enters corresponding fixation hole 66, due to bullet The presence of spring 26, the second adjusting rod 44 can effectively enter in fixation hole 66, and strainer cover 10 is fixed, when second When adjusting rod 44 is fully entered in corresponding fixation hole 66, adjustable plate 3 is rested in the second locating rod 71, and is in a horizontal state;
(4) motor 31 is then adjusted by the starting of controller 86 second, makes 34 rapid desufflation of striker plate, 38 bottom of locating slot Port opening, strainer cover 10 is due to gravity, and freely falling body, along 44 slide downward of the second adjusting rod, striker plate 34 is very thin, the Two adjusting rods 44 with the corresponding bar 68 that transfers in same vertical straight line, so, strainer cover 10 is inevitable to be adjusted along second Pole 44 slide into it is corresponding transfer on bar 68, while by 86 starting shock device 70 of controller, make to transfer bar 68 and carry out gently Micro- vibration accelerates the speed that strainer cover 10 slides, prevents strainer cover 10 to be stuck in the second adjusting rod 44 or transfer bar 68 On;
(5) after strainer cover 10, which fully enters, transfers the fixation of bar 68, pass through controller 86 and start the drive of the second electric hydaulic Dynamic device 85, makes to transfer bar 68 and moves downward, and shrinks, and enables to transfer bar 68 and does not touch diversion trench 6 in subsequent rotation Bottom guarantees whole stability,
(6) after transferring bar 68 and moving downwardly to the distance of setting, pass through controller 86, close the driving of the second electric hydaulic Device 85, while motor 22 is transferred in starting, makes to transfer the angle that axis 23 rotates clockwise setting, makes to transfer on disk 21 and transfer bar 68 are connected to each other with the tapping Fixing clamp-seat 30 on automatic tapping machine 28, make to transfer the strainer cover 10 on bar 68 by transferring bar 68 It slides on tapping Fixing clamp-seat 30, while by 86 starting shock device 70 of controller, makes to transfer bar 68 and carry out slight vibration, Accelerate the speed that strainer cover 10 slides, strainer cover 10 is prevented to be stuck on tapping Fixing clamp-seat 30 or transfer on bar 68, when When strainer cover 10 is fully entered on tapping Fixing clamp-seat 30, then completion is fed;
(7) it when transferring disk 21 while rotation, pushes drive rod 78 to rotate, passes through the lever principle of drive rod 78, band The horizontal movement of dynamic second rack gear 81 drives shaft 17 to be rotated, to make the first tune to be driven by second gear 72 Pole is switched to upwards by downward vertical state, can be restored automatically to initial position, when transferring disk and returning, due to snap-gauge and the The presence of three connecting rods enables to transfer disk auto-returned, unaffected, due to mentioning to realize circulation in cycles High whole efficiency.
(8) after the completion of charging, then motor 22 is transferred by the starting of controller 86, makes to transfer the recovery of disk 21 to initial bit Set, then start the second electro-hydraulic device 85, make to transfer bar 68 and rise to 34 bottom of striker plate, wait next time into Material.
